OAF Page to Upload Files into Server from local Machine

1. Create a New Workspace and Project
File > New > General > Workspace Configured for Oracle Applications

File Name – PrajkumarFileUploadDemo

Automatically a new OA Project will also be created

Project Name -- FileUploadDemo
Default Package -- prajkumar.oracle.apps.fnd.fileuploaddemo

2. Create a New Application Module (AM)
Right Click on FileUploadDemo > New > ADF Business Components > Application Module
Name -- FileUploadAM
Package -- prajkumar.oracle.apps.fnd.fileuploaddemo.server
Check Application Module Class: FileUploadAMImpl Generate JavaFile(s)

3. Create a New Page
Right click on FileUploadDemo > New > Web Tier > OA Components > Page
Name -- FileUploadPG
Package -- prajkumar.oracle.apps.fnd.fileuploaddemo.webui

4. Select the FileUploadPG and go to the strcuture pane where a default region has been created

5. Select region1 and set the following properties --
   
Attribute
Property
ID
PageLayoutRN
AM Definition
prajkumar.oracle.apps.fnd.fileuploaddemo.server.FileUploadAM
Window Title
Uploading File into Server from Local Machine Demo Window
Title
Uploading File into Server from Local Machine Demo
   
6. Create messageComponentLayout Region Under Page Layout Region
Right click PageLayoutRN > New > Region

Attribute
Property
ID
MainRN
Item Style
messageComponentLayout

7. Create a New Item messageFileUpload Bean under MainRN
Right click on MainRN > New > messageFileUpload
Set Following Properties for New Item --

Attribute
Property
ID
MessageFileUpload
Item Style
messageFileUpload

8. Create a New Item Submit Button Bean under MainRN
Right click on MainRN > New > messageLayout
Set Following Properties for messageLayout --

Attribute
Property
ID
ButtonLayout

Right Click on ButtonLayout > New > Item

Attribute
Property
ID
Submit
Item Style
submitButton
Attribute Set
/oracle/apps/fnd/attributesets/Buttons/Go

9. Create Controller for page FileUploadPG
Right Click on PageLayoutRN > Set New Controller
Package Name: prajkumar.oracle.apps.fnd.fileuploaddemo.webui
Class Name: FileUploadCO

Write Following Code in FileUploadCO processFormRequest
import oracle.cabo.ui.data.DataObject;
import java.io.FileOutputStream;
import java.io.InputStream;
import oracle.jbo.domain.BlobDomain;
import java.io.File;
import oracle.apps.fnd.framework.OAException;
public void processFormRequest(OAPageContext pageContext, OAWebBean webBean)
{ super.processFormRequest(pageContext, webBean);  
 if(pageContext.getParameter("Submit")!=null)
 {
  upLoadFile(pageContext,webBean);    
 }
}

CODE #1 -- If Page has not deployed at instance, testing at Local Machine, use following Code
public void upLoadFile(OAPageContext pageContext,OAWebBean webBean)
{ String filePath = "D:\\PRajkumar";
 System.out.println("Default File Path---->"+filePath);
 String fileUrl = null;
 try
 {
  DataObject fileUploadData =  pageContext.getNamedDataObject("MessageFileUpload");
//FileUploading is my MessageFileUpload Bean Id
  if(fileUploadData!=null)
  {
   String uFileName = (String)fileUploadData.selectValue(null, "UPLOAD_FILE_NAME"); 

   String contentType = (String) fileUploadData.selectValue(null, "UPLOAD_FILE_MIME_TYPE");  
   System.out.println("User File Name---->"+uFileName);
   FileOutputStream output = null;
   InputStream input = null;
   BlobDomain uploadedByteStream = (BlobDomain)fileUploadData.selectValue(null, uFileName);
   System.out.println("uploadedByteStream---->"+uploadedByteStream);
                          
   File file = new File("D:\\PRajkumar", uFileName);  
   System.out.println("File output---->"+file);
   output = new FileOutputStream(file);
   System.out.println("output----->"+output);
   input = uploadedByteStream.getInputStream();
   System.out.println("input---->"+input);
   byte abyte0[] = new byte[0x19000];
   int i;
    
   while((i = input.read(abyte0)) > 0)
   output.write(abyte0, 0, i);
   output.close();
   input.close();
  }
 }
 catch(Exception ex)
 {
  throw new OAException(ex.getMessage(), OAException.ERROR);
 }    
}

CODE #2 -- If Page has been Deployed at Instance, Use Following Code 
public void upLoadFile(OAPageContext pageContext,OAWebBean webBean)
{ String filePath = "/u01/app/apnac03r12/PRajkumar/";
 System.out.println("Default File Path---->"+filePath);
 String fileUrl = null;
 try
 {
  DataObject fileUploadData =  pageContext.getNamedDataObject("MessageFileUpload");
//FileUploading is my MessageFileUpload Bean Id
  if(fileUploadData!=null)
  {
   String uFileName = (String)fileUploadData.selectValue(null, "UPLOAD_FILE_NAME");  
   String contentType = (String) fileUploadData.selectValue(null, "UPLOAD_FILE_MIME_TYPE");  
   System.out.println("User File Name---->"+uFileName);
   FileOutputStream output = null;
   InputStream input = null;
   BlobDomain uploadedByteStream = (BlobDomain)fileUploadData.selectValue(null, uFileName);
   System.out.println("uploadedByteStream---->"+uploadedByteStream);
                          
   File file = new File("/u01/app/apnac03r12/PRajkumar", uFileName);  
   System.out.println("File output---->"+file);
   output = new FileOutputStream(file);
   System.out.println("output----->"+output);
   input = uploadedByteStream.getInputStream();
   System.out.println("input---->"+input);
   byte abyte0[] = new byte[0x19000];
   int i;
    
   while((i = input.read(abyte0)) > 0)
   output.write(abyte0, 0, i);
   output.close();
   input.close();
  }
 }
 catch(Exception ex)
 {
  throw new OAException(ex.getMessage(), OAException.ERROR);
 }    
}

10. Congratulation you have successfully finished. Run Your page and Test Your Work
